DRA secures Exxaro contract

Global engineering firm DRA has secured a contract with Exxaro Coal Mpumalanga, a subsidiary of Exxaro Resources, to construct a 500t/h coal handling and preparation plant in Mpumalanga, South Africa

The coal handling and preparation plant consists of primary and secondary sizing stations, overland conveyor, two 7,500t silos, low gravity and high gravity dense medium separation (DMS) modules, thickener circuit, filter plant and a stacker conveyor. The plant will produce both a domestic and an export product.

The project will commence in January 2018 and is expected to be completed in October 2019.
